White gazpacho with grapes and roasted almonds

Ingredients

Directions

  1. Save 1 cup of chopped cucumbers for garnish. Soak bread in water until soft, about 2 minutes. In a food processor bowl, place the soaked bread, leftover cucumber, garlic, 3 onion stalks, vinegar, lemon juice, 1/4 tbsp. almonds, salt, 3 tbsp. l. olive oil and beat until the cucumbers are completely chopped and the liquid and almonds are almost invisible, about 1-2 minutes. Add more salt and vinegar if desired. To serve, place 1 cup gazpacho in a bowl. Spread out 1/4 tbsp. left chopped cucumber, a tablespoon of green onions, 2 tbsp. l. grapes and a teaspoon of almonds in the center of the soup bowl.
